Привет, ЛОР!
Есть официальный ebuild для C++ ORM — ODB, точнее, для одного из компонентов — libodb.
https://git.btbn.de/gitweb/odb-overlay.git/blob_plain/HEAD:/dev-db/libodb/lib...
Хочу его портировать на EAPI 6, с планами отправить патчи в апстрим и, по возможности, добавить его основное дерево Gentoo.
Знаю, что autotools-utils забанен в EAPI 6.
Ок, а какой eclass в EAPI 6 отвечает за IUSE doc
и static-libs
?
В чём смысл строки --docdir="${T}"
, если в каталоге /var/tmp/portage/dev-cpp/libodb-2.4.0/temp
никакой документации я не обнаружил?
UPDATE
grep -r static-libs /usr/portage/eclass
toolchain-binutils.eclass
и autotools-utils.eclass
не нашёл, но autotools-utils.eclass
забанили в EAPI 6, а toolchain-binutils.eclass
никакой другой eclass вроде не инклудит.